# This is a sample configuration file. You can generate your configuration
 | 
						|
# with the `bundle exec rails mastodon:setup` interactive setup wizard, but to customize
 | 
						|
# your setup even further, you'll need to edit it manually. This sample does
 | 
						|
# not demonstrate all available configuration options. Please look at
 | 
						|
# https://docs.joinmastodon.org/admin/config/ for the full documentation.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Note that this file accepts slightly different syntax depending on whether
 | 
						|
# you are using `docker-compose` or not. In particular, if you use
 | 
						|
# `docker-compose`, the value of each declared variable will be taken verbatim,
 | 
						|
# including surrounding quotes.
 | 
						|
# See: https://github.com/mastodon/mastodon/issues/16895

# Encryption secrets
 | 
						|
# ------------------
 | 
						|
# Must be available (and set to same values) for all server processes
 | 
						|
# These are private/secret values, do not share outside hosting environment
 | 
						|
# Use `bin/rails db:encryption:init` to generate fresh secrets
 | 
						|
# Do NOT change these secrets once in use, as this would cause data loss and other issues
 | 
						|
# ------------------
 | 
						|
#ACTIVE_RECORD_ENCRYPTION_DETERMINISTIC_KEY=
 | 
						|
#ACTIVE_RECORD_ENCRYPTION_KEY_DERIVATION_SALT=
 | 
						|
#ACTIVE_RECORD_ENCRYPTION_PRIMARY_KEY=

# IP and session retention
 | 
						|
# -----------------------
 | 
						|
# Make sure to modify the scheduling of ip_cleanup_scheduler in config/sidekiq.yml
 | 
						|
# to be less than daily if you lower IP_RETENTION_PERIOD below two days (172800).
 | 
						|
# -----------------------
 | 
						|
IP_RETENTION_PERIOD=31556952
 | 
						|
SESSION_RETENTION_PERIOD=31556952

# Fetch All Replies Behavior
 | 
						|
# --------------------------
 | 
						|
# When a user expands a post (DetailedStatus view), fetch all of its replies
 | 
						|
# (default: false)
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_ENABLED=false
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Period to wait between fetching replies (in minutes)
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_COOLDOWN_MINUTES=15
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Period to wait after a post is first created before fetching its replies (in minutes)
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_INITIAL_WAIT_MINUTES=5
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Max number of replies to fetch - total, recursively through a whole reply tree
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_MAX_GLOBAL=1000
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Max number of replies to fetch - for a single post
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_MAX_SINGLE=500
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
# Max number of replies Collection pages to fetch - total
 | 
						|
FETCH_REPLIES_MAX_PAGES=500
